Message type: E = Error
Message class: CM_MDQLTYRULEMINING - Messages for Rule Mining Run
Message number: 033
Message text: Rule mining run &1 cannot be deleted. Please try again later.

- Rule mining run &1 cannot be deleted. Please try again later. ?The SAP error message CM_MDQLTYRULEMINING033 indicates that a rule mining run cannot be deleted at the moment. This typically occurs in the context of data quality management or rule mining processes within SAP systems, particularly in the context of SAP Data Services or SAP Information Steward.
Cause:
- Ongoing Process: The most common reason for this error is that the rule mining run is currently in progress or has not yet completed. If the process is still active, the system will prevent deletion to maintain data integrity.
- Locks: There may be locks on the database or the specific rule mining run that prevent it from being deleted.
- User Permissions: The user attempting to delete the run may not have the necessary permissions to perform this action.
- System Issues: There could be underlying system issues or bugs that are causing the deletion process to fail.
Solution:
- Wait and Retry: If the rule mining run is still in progress, wait for it to complete and then try deleting it again.
- Check Status: Verify the status of the rule mining run. If it is stuck or not progressing, you may need to investigate further or contact your system administrator.
- Release Locks: If there are locks preventing deletion, you may need to release them. This can often be done through transaction codes like SM12 (to view and delete locks) or SM21 (to check system logs).
- Permissions Check: Ensure that you have the necessary permissions to delete the rule mining run. If not, contact your system administrator to grant the required access.
- System Logs: Check the system logs for any additional error messages or warnings that might provide more context about the issue.
- Contact Support: If the issue persists, consider reaching out to SAP support for assistance, especially if you suspect a bug or system issue.
